Cricket Australia reaffirms desire to host India-Pakistan bilateral series

Image
Cricket Australia has reaffirmed its willingness to host a bilateral series between India and Pakistan if the BCCI and PCB agree to playing each other in the future. India and Pakistan's men's teams will be in Australia at the same time in November this year after CA announced the schedule for Australia's next home summer with Pakistan playing three ODIs and T20Is before India start a five-Test series just four days later on November 22, although there was never a realistic chance of matches between the two nations as part of the visits. India and Pakistan have not played a bilateral series since 2012-13 and currently only meet at global ICC events. After the success of the 2022 T20 World Cup match between India and Pakistan at the MCG, when 90,293 witnessed a last-ball thriller, CA, the Melbourne Cricket Club (operators of the MCG) and the Victorian government expressed an interest in hosting the two teams in bilateral matches at the MCG. Catastrophic' floods in Central Europe as firefighter dies in rescue

Image
Thousands without power in Poland near Czech border The first drowning death in Poland has been verified by Prime Minister Donald Tusk, but the village where it happened has been shut off, making it impossible for authorities to get to it. Over 1,600 residents of the Kłodzko region, which is close to the Czech border, have had to leave their houses. It's one of the worst hit locations; in some portions of the town, the water has gotten as low as 1.5 meters (4.9 feet). In the Kłodzko district alone, some 17,000 individuals lack electricity, and mobile phone and internet connections are broken. Tusk has approved the internet's usage of Starlink satellite technology. A Blackhawk chopper has been sent to the region to rescue individuals who are stuck on rooftops.
